Comment (v. i.) To make remarks, observations, or criticism; especially, to write notes on the works of an author, with a view to illustrate his meaning, or to explain particular passages; to write annotations; -- often followed by on or upon..

Commentate :: Commentate (v. t. & i.) To write comments or notes upon; to make comments.
Glossist :: Glossist (n.) A writer of comments.
Parenthesis :: Parenthesis (n.) A word, phrase, or sentence, by way of comment or explanation, inserted in, or attached to, a sentence which would be grammatically complete without it. It is usually inclosed within curved lines (see def. 2 below), or dashes..
Commentatorship :: Commentatorship (n.) The office or occupation of a commentator.
Commentary :: Commentary (v. i.) A series of comments or annotations; esp., a book of explanations or expositions on the whole or a part of the Scriptures or of some other work..
Commentitious :: Commentitious (a.) Fictitious or imaginary; unreal; as, a commentitious system of religion..
Commentator :: Commentator (n.) One who writes a commentary or comments; an expositor; an annotator.
Footnote :: Footnote (n.) A note of reference or comment at the foot of a page.
Commented :: Commented (imp. & p. p.) of Commen.
Commentaries :: Commentaries (pl. ) of Commentar.
Postil :: Postil (n.) A short homily or commentary on a passage of Scripture; as, the first postils were composed by order of Charlemagne..
Gemara :: Gemara (n.) The second part of the Talmud, or the commentary on the Mishna (which forms the first part or text)..
Explainer :: Explainer (n.) One who explains; an expounder or expositor; a commentator; an interpreter.
Scholiast :: Scholiast (n.) A maker of scholia; a commentator or annotator.
Commenter :: Commenter (n.) One who makes or writes comments; a commentator; an annotator.
Glossographer :: Glossographer (n.) A writer of a glossary; a commentator; a scholiast.
Comment :: Comment (n.) A note or observation intended to explain, illustrate, or criticise the meaning of a writing, book, etc.; explanation; annotation; exposition..
Commentation :: Commentation (n.) The result of the labors of a commentator.
Postillate :: Postillate (v. i.) To write postils; to comment.
Gloss :: Gloss (v. t.) To render clear and evident by comments; to illustrate; to explain; to annotate.
